Seared Spicy Tuna on Basil Parmesan Crisps With Apricot Jam

  • Level: Intermediate
  • Yield: 16 pieces
  • Total: 30 min
  • Prep: 20 min
  • Cook: 10 min

Ingredients

1-pound piece sushi grade tuna

2 tablespoons Cajun spice rub

3/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ese

1/4 cup chopped fresh basil

1 tsp olive oil

1/2 cup apricot jam

Directions

  1. Rub tuna with Cajun seasoning and set aside. In small bowl mix cheese and basil. Place tablespoons of the cheese mixture on a baking sheet lined with a silicon baking mat or wax paper sprayed with nonstick spray. Bake in a 350-degree oven for 6 minutes or until cheese is melted and golden. Set aside to cool. Heat oil in a medium pan and cook tuna 2 min per side for medium rare. Thinly slice tuna place it on top of the Parmesan crisps along with a dollop of apricot jam.
